FIASCHETTI v. NASH ENGINEERING CO.

(AC 16500)

47 Conn. App. 443 (1998)

FRANK FIASCHETTI v. NASH ENGINEERING COMPANY

Appellate Court of Connecticut.

Officially released January 13, 1998.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Thomas E. Mangines, with whom, on the brief, was Brian A. Mangines, for the appellant (plaintiff).

Andrew Houlding, with whom, on the brief, was John A. Sabanosh, for the appellee (defendant).

Lavery, Spear and Daly, JS.


Opinion

SPEAR, J.

The plaintiff, Frank Fiaschetti, appeals from the summary judgment rendered in favor of the defendant, Nash Engineering Company.
